Transaction 53ce3a1663a2c44453e297f062d068bef72df660aaf863e863c81d9c69f0c5ac
1 Input
1 Output
-
53ce3a1663a2c44453e297f062d068bef72df660aaf863e863c81d9c69f0c5ac:0
- value
- 104903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8014fe1ed18c1cc9e60a17120aee43566704e0c0 OP_EQUAL
- address
- 3DNFZhB7m3PbfQcEkLML2obLc72boFy5sv